Forex trading, or foreign exchange current exchange trading, is a global phenomenon. This is the single largest market in the world. There are many different market sectors that are involved with Forex trading. These include, but are not limited to; " Banks" Corporations" Governments" IndividualsWhat is Forex trading you ask? At its simplest, Forex trading is currency being traded for another currency. However, Forex trading is anything but simple. The market has massive trade volume and is very fluid. Not to mention the hundreds of different currencies being traded and their ever changing value.Forex trading is a very focused area of trading, but the amount of time andenergy most people and companies spend getting trained and educated on Forex trading and its inner workings and pitfalls, is at least as much time as it takes to learn the stock market.Because of the complexity, Forex Trading is not your typical overnight success operation. There are many large corporations, such as GCI Financial which is a market leader in this space.Forex trading is unique in that everyone does not have access to all of the same information and prices at the same time, as they do with the stock market. I won't get into specifics here, but basically there is a tiered level whereby different levels of access are given to the Forex traders and Forex firms.The other main thing to remember about Forex trading is, until such time that the world adopts a single currency, Forex Trading will be around for a very long time.

A Look at Online Forex Brokers
An online forex broker is a firm that facilitates retail trading using Internet technologies. Global Forex Trading (GFT), one of the popular online forex brokers. It provides retail traders with a free demo trading account, allows users to open a live account, gives live help, provides software called DealBook FX 2, and allows viewing of account documents. (DealBook FX 2 can be downloaded for the demo trading account).Gain Capital Group's Online Forex offers 200:1 leverage. In some cases, the total return on investment is higher due to leverage. For example, with $1000 cash in a margin account, the investor can control up to $200,000 in notional value. Of course, trading on leverage magnifies both the investor's profits and losses. GCI Financial Ltd. offers commission-free online trading in forex. GCI offers Internet trading software, fast and efficient execution, and 0.5% margin requirements. This broker offers USD or Euro denominated trading accounts. The spreads are 3 pips in EUR/USD and USD/JPY, and are 4 to 5 pips for other major commissions. Clients can hedge by opening positions in the same currency in opposite directions. Risk to the investor is limited to the deposited funds. Market analysis and research, real-time charts, and forex trading signals are available at no charge.ACM, part of the REFCO group, offers 3 pip spreads on all major currencies, which works out to between 0.02% and 0.03% on the dollar value. They also offer commission-free trading, and forex trading with a 1% margin, which means that a trader can control $1,000,000 with $10,000 in his account.There are many online forex brokers that offer free demo accounts for potential forex traders to practice trading. It is only a matter of registering and starting demo trading to get a feel for forex trading. In addition, at most sites, traders can find free forex news to assist them with their trade strategies.

Why Trade the Forex Market
Trading the Forex market has become very popular in the last years. Technology advances like the internet have spawned this new trading craze, where anyone with a secure internet connection prepared to undertake a small amount of training can engage in trading foreign exchange on the forex market. Before the Internet, only corporations and wealthy individuals could trade currencies in the Forex market through the use of proprietary trading systems of banks, often through private banking. The foreign exchange market is one of the largest in the world if not the largest. It is more than 3 times larger than the stock/equities market and more than 5 times bigger than futures, give Forex traders nearly unlimited liquidity and flexibility. It has been estimated that approximately $2 trillion USD of currency exchanges hands each and every day. The foreign currency markets are very liquid because worldwide, the most powerful international banks provide a market around the clock. The Global foreign exchange market daily averages of the Bank for International Settlements in 1998 were $660 billion and now have increased to $2.3 trillion (2006). There is really no insider information in the forex markets. Since exchange rates are calculated by actual money flow as well as by the outlook of financial flowage, which takes into consideration such things as inflation, GDP changes, trade and budget deficits and surpluses, as well as interest rates, it would be difficult to come across so-called 'insider information'. All of these factors are self-evident, though different projected outlooks may prove more accurate than others. There is less room for market manipulation is there may be for thinly traded stocks. A equally important property of forex market is the fact that trends in forex market last longer and are more clearly defined than in any other trading instrument. Analysis of forex market charts also often displays identifiable chart patterns of price movement and once a pattern is established, the trend or pattern becomes the most probable course of future price action until the market changes. Because the FOREX market is so huge, there is no possibility of someone controlling the market price for a long time. When there are a lot of buyers and a lot of sellers, you can expect to buy or sell at a price that is very close to the last market price. The market maker in the forex market is usually a bank or brokerage company that provides during the trading day a bid and ask price. Example of forex market makers include CMS Forex, GFS, Forex, Forex Capital Markets (FXCM), and Global Forex Trading, all of which are regulated by the Commodity Futures Trading Commission (CFTC) of the USA. Brokers offer clients access to online FX trading system, platform or software that can make it easy and fun to trade the market and usually there are usually no commission charges. With these trading systems and platforms you can trade the forex markets for free using the same state-of-the-art software packages that professional Forex traders use to help them make real-time, live currency trades. So individuals with a few hundreds of their own currency hope to buy and sell something for a smiling profit. Speculators trade to make a profit by purchasing one currency and simultaneously selling another. In conclusion I think the FOREX market is one of the best investment opportunities around today. There are great opportunities in the FOREX market because of the constant movements of the exchange rates. There is no surprise that more and more traders are turning to the foreign currency market to take advantage of the fluctuation in exchange currency rates as a way to speculate and trade to increase their capital and wealth.

Unique Commodity Trading Strategies To Survive And Prosper During Tough Markets
Surviving the rough times to be present for the big moves is the name of the game in commodity trading. With some luck we can even break even while the other participants are getting chopped to pieces. It requires giving up something to get something else. Learn how a few of the big hits can be avoided for a small price. Read about ways to participate in the long haul moves while still sleeping well at night.Let's say our forecast makes us bullish on the market. We want to check out the possibility of buying a future contract and hedging it by buying a put option. There will always be a choice here - either buying an option spread (as in the previous example) or buying a future with an option hedge. One method will always be better than the other. We need to determine this to get our strategy edge on the market. Much depends on the option premiums. Again, this is where it's handy to have an automated option evaluation program.Now we can get creative and more flexible. Let's say you have faith in your forecast that the market is going to rally within 2 - 3 weeks. If it doesn't happen by then, then the trade is suspect. Let's buy a futures contract and also buy a put option as close to the current market price as possible. Hopefully we pay a reasonable price for the put option. The closer you buy it, the less loss and risk if the futures contract declines sharply against you. However, the option premium will be higher too.The put option becomes a synthetic stop loss order for the futures contract. You will lose until the market hits that option strike price and then no matter how far the market drops, the futures contract loss is fixed and limited. Now here's the trick and edge...Select an option with only a small amount of time, like 30 days or so. The option will cost less because of having a short time remaining. If your future contract moves up within 2-3 weeks as you expect, the put option will lose its value quickly and expire within 30 days anyway. The option is the sacrificial lamb that has done its job for a few weeks and then dies. It has protected you against the big potential hit. We dodged the ball. Now it's up to the futures contract. That's where the profit will come from, if the trade is destined to work out.Once the futures contract gets far away from your entry point under the initial protection of the option, you can then move up the future's stop loss order to break-even. A new option could always be bought later if desired to synthetically lock in some profits. However, this is option overuse and the premiums start to catch up with you. We must take on risk or the market will not pay us. We become parasites if we hedge too much, add no liquidity or load risk onto others. In this example we economically used an option to lay off large risk at a critical time. After that brief, partially-hedged window, we again assumed the risk. There are other ways to do this, but beyond the scope of this article. More later.So far we have discussed entry techniques and ways to lower our risk at critical times when our exposure is the greatest. Remember that we are trying NOT to get hit by the dodge-ball and are happy making singles and doubles. Let the newbies swing for the fences and strike out 90% of the time. The idea here is survival until we identify a big market forecast and the move starts. That's the only time to swing for the fences. You want to play it conservative 90% of the time and swing hard 10% at most. To do otherwise is the road to consistent losses. Trade like a guerrilla warfare fighter. Survival first, shoot at our own time and place...sparingly. Let the others line themselves up and face off to their heart's desire. In another article we will discuss methods of using futures and options for synthetic exit strategies. This will include option granting, and futures hedging of options. Good Trading

Learn Forex Trading In An Innovative And Easy Way
Why Learn Forex trading?The forex market is by far the largest market in the world. It is estimated that around $1.5 TRILLION is traded every single day. By far more then all the stock, bond and futures markets of the entire world combined! Forex or currency exchange is the term used to describe the trading of world currencies. A trade occurs when a trader simultaneously buy of one currency and sell of another one. E.g., to buy British pounds with US dollars. The currency combination used in a trade is called a pair.What does a forex trader do? Simple, buy a currency at a low value and sell it at a higher value, and in the process profit from it! For example, buy Great British Pounds with US Dollars, wait for the Pound rate to go up and make money! This can be done several times a day if the forex trader is a day trader or several times a week or month if the trader is a forex swing trader.What are the main benefits of trading in the forex market?Many currency pairs are very volatile. Volatility means that they move a lot during the day, from side to side, allowing traders to capture sometimes 5-6 price swings per day, each one potentially allowing the trader to make impressive profits.5-7 currency pairs to monitor (instead of over 10,000 stocks!), no commission trading, guaranteed fills for stop losses and limit orders, impressive leverage. The forex market is a 24 hour market. Never stops. This means that as a forex trader you can chose exactly when to trade. Some traders have day jobs and do not have the necessary time to trade during the day so they can trade at night. People who make their living as forex traders can chose to trade any time of the day or night. The point being, a 24 hour market allows the trader a lot of flexibility.What are the Exclusive benefits offered by forex trading?An incredible benefit of the forex industry is that today all forex brokers allow traders to open free demo accounts. This demo account has the full capabilities of a "real" account including live market rates, access to real-time market analysis, and the ability to execute trades off streaming prices. This means that the trader can test his or her strategies without risking a single dollar! No other business opportunity allows you to see if it works before you spend money!Making a living as a forex trader allows you to be truly free! No office, no workers, no inventory, no marketing worries, no advertising, no selling. Learning the right forex trading system allows the forex trader to trade by just following simple rules. If A happens and B happens then do C. This is called mechanical trading. It requires absolutely no discretion, interpretation or thinking from the trader.In conclusion, Learning forex trading provides all level of investors with a lot of opportunities that many markets and industries do not provide. The reason many people have not heard of this opportunity until recently is that until not long ago trading currencies was reserved to the big dogs (banks, institutions, companies etc). Today with the help of the internet anyone can take advantage of on-line currency trading that was once reserved to an exclusive group.
